The Two Jess(es) get a chance to chat with their friend and WeSTAT community member, Deirdre Taylor, about working on the front lines of COVID in New York City as a travel nurse for the last two months. Deirdre details her experience working with some of the hardest hit populations in NYC, her reasons for going, and how her family managed in her absence.

This is a hero's story within another hero's story. Deirdre shares her life long search for a fire fighter that had pulled her from a burning building as a child. While Deirdre spent the past weeks fighting for sick patients lives, she was rewarded with the phone number for HER fire fighter...after all these years.

Deirdre Taylor resides in Alexandria, VA with her husband and two amazing children. She’s a former Army helicopter pilot who became a registered nurse after deciding to leave the military to focus on starting a family. She has spent the majority of her nursing career working in the Emergency Departments of busy, Level 1 trauma centers.
